Color assignments on maps of concentrations of any constituent are arbitrary, and provided as a key on the map. There is no "natural" means of providing such a representative color. On the maps provided by the US-NASA, high ozone concentrations are yellow or white, and low concentrations are depected as dark blue, with intermediate values usually in red. So on US-NASA maps, the ozone hole is usually shown as a red circle with a blue center, when it is winter at that pole. See the link below.
